Why not Cherry or MX switch knockoffs or MX style switch? A knockoff is an imitation or copy of something, so calling them MX switch knockoffs covers the whole scope from the exact clones to the ones that are different, but MX compatible. MX style switches also covers the whole range of switches since it's saying they can be exact replicas or similar style and compatible switches.
I bring this up because I've found an Alps-style knockoff switch on Taobao recently that, following the proposed MX compatible terminology would fit under that term and Alps compatible since the base appears to have the same exact bottom layout as an MX switch, complete with PCB stabilizers, but has an Alps slider (
switch in question). So technically, it's both MX and Alps compatible.
